.AIN is Source Engine Compiled AI Nodegraph File

Game data file used by games developed with Source, a first-person shooter (FPS) game engine developed by Valve; stores a navigation mesh, which consists of points and connected lines that make up potential traversal paths for artificial intelligence (AI) non-player characters (NPCs), or "bots;" used for real-time navigation and movement for AI computer players.

The original nodegraph is created using the Level Designer component of the Source engine SDK, which is called the Valve Hammer Editor. Once complete, an AIN file is automatically compiled by the Source engine when the game is loaded. The compiled AIN file is saved to the \maps\graphs\ directory within the game installation directory.

NOTE: The Valve Source engine is used for games such as Half-Life 2 and Team Fortress 2.

File Type 2 AIN Compressed File Archive
Category: Compressed Files

File or group of file compressed with AIN compression software; AIN was a shareware archiving program available for MS-DOS in the 1990s.
